Title: | Black Figure Column Krater Fragments | |
Category: | Pottery | |
Description: | Numerous joining fragments make up two pieces. a) Wall fragment: warrior running between mantle figures. b) Wall, shoulder and neck fragment: satyrs and maenads. A satyr at the left pursues three maenads, the foremost two of which look back with left hands raised. Degenerate tongues above scene. Red for forelock and beard of satyr; spots on all garments, stripe on cloak of maenad at the right, stripe on casque of warrior. White for sword strap, device (two balls) on shield of warrior, flesh of women, dotted pattern on the cloak of the maenad on the left. Thin brown glaze inside. Interior of neck glazed. | |
